(THR) Political Ad Revenue Propels Nexstar in Fourth Quarter, The CW Posts $94M Loss

“Local TV giant Nexstar reported a blockbuster fourth quarter, driven mostly by explosive growth in political advertising. That is especially clear when looking at the company’s core advertising revenue (which does not include political), which was down slightly year-over-year, consistent with the rest of the industry.” Click here to continue reading via The Hollywood Reporter.
